Google Mobile now available in 38 different languages
Phones Review —
... Since March the availability to the new iPhone has been expanded to over 20 countries. And now the experience can be had by feature phones in the Us and Japan and the new format is now more widely available.
If you have mobile internet access regardless of whether you own a smartphone or a feature phone you can now get the new mobile-optimized Google search results pages on your phone. Just visit Google.com in your mobile browser and conduct a search.
